What is the difference between DNA proofreading and mismatch repair?

DNA proofreading occurs during DNA replication and involves the DNA polymerase enzyme checking for errors in base pairing as it synthesizes a new DNA strand. Mismatch repair occurs after DNA replication and involves specialized enzymes that recognize and remove mismatched base pairs that were not corrected during proofreading. In other Words, proofreading happens during synthesis, while mismatch repair occurs after synthesis is complete.
